Autodesk Inventor/Vault Manager Bootcamp 4-Day

In this training, the student will learn the Inventor and Vault 2026 content creation and management.  Items include administration of templates, advanced configuration, settings, team standards and deployment, MSSQL, and troubleshooting and documentation steps for support.  This training is 8 hours per day for four days.  

This training is tailored to users with a solid understanding of Autodesk Inventor.  Fundamentals will not be covered and are expected to be well understood for the best user classroom experience.

Prerequisites:

  • Basic understanding of mechanical engineering, Autodesk Inventor, and Vault
  • Inventor 2026 installed and running*
  • Vault Basic 2026 Client and Server installed and running **
  • Vault Professional 2026 Client and Server installed and running**
  • Microsoft Excel installed and running
